Enhance Air Quality

A chimney can negatively impact the inside air purity in one's house. Whenever you ignite a blaze, particulate matter and creosote build up and have the potential to discharge hazardous substances into your air. Exposure to these contaminants can be particularly hazardous for people with respiratory issues or sensitivities. Periodic flue cleanings assistance to getting rid of of harmful pollutants, boosting air quality, and promising a healthier residential atmosphere for yourself and your loved ones.

Improve Energy Efficiency

Maintaining top-notch energy efficiency in one's home necessitates a clean chimney. Once carbon particles and creosote gather in your chimney, they can impede the flow of air, causing suboptimal performance of your fire pit or wood heater. Such a situation means you'll need to consume more fuel to generate the same amount of warmth, leading in higher heating bills. By consistently cleaning your chimney, you can clear away these, making sure that your heating system runs at maximum efficiency, ultimately reducing you and your family money.

Stop Carbon Monoxide Poisoning

Carbon monoxide is a invisible and unscented substance generated when fuel is partially consumed. A clogged or unclean chimney might hinder proper carbon monoxide discharge, permitting it to gather inside of your house. Increased amounts of carbon monoxide in the environment can be extremely dangerous, possibly fatal. Periodic flue cleanings can help make sure there are zero impediments or stoppages that could result in carbon monoxide buildup, thereby ensuring you protected.

Avoiding Chimney Fires

One of the most compelling justifications to give importance to routine chimney cleaning is the prevention of chimney fires. Soot and creosote can accumulate over time in your chimney, creating a very ignitable atmosphere. Should left, these deposits can catch aflame, causing a fatal blaze that swiftly spreads throughout your home. You have the ability to dramatically decrease the risk of chimney fires and protect the well-being of your household and your home by scheduling regular chimney cleanings.

Chimney Safety Tips

Your fire pit provides a gorgeous enhancement to your appearance of your home, however it might also pose dangers if you have not spent the effort to verify that your chimney is in proper shape. Follow these steps here to assure the safety measures of your household's chimney:

Schedule a Chimney Inspection

The primary actions in guaranteeing your chimney is secure is to have it inspected and cleared in case necessary. Given that the inspecting professional will be able to inform you of your chimney, you can steer clear of potential blazes or carbon monoxide risks.

Cover Your Chimney

Secure the top of your fireplace flue whenever you're not using the fireplace. A cap is typically made of stainless steel, preventing oxidation. This cap is designed with the goal of stop pests, dirt, and leaves from clogging the normal gas flow.

Keep It Simple

Be sure to keep a safe distance between your decor and any fire pit. Being exposed to heat carries the potential of combust over time.

Install a Screen or a Door

Adding screens or glass panel doors in front of your home's fire pit can help manage embers and keep them clear of the carpet or decor. If there are little ones, this will add a further barrier of security. For glass panel doors, never leave them closed while an active fireplace fire.

Detectors That Work

Make sure to fire and CO alarms are current and in working order. Install the detectors on your ceiling, because it's the most probable spot for smoke or carbon monoxide to ascend.

Fire Starter

Utilize a fire starter specifically designed for use inside a fire pit. It's not allowed to utilize fuel, lighter fluid, or a charcoal grill lighter. Such kinds of lighters can cause flames to get excessively large, increasing the risk of fire. Furthermore, a few of these are considered an accelerant, which can may leave residues within the flue, perhaps leading to ignition inside of your flue.

Clean Outside the Chimney

Although the interior of the inside of the chimney is frequently discussed as it is the most prominent part, the region surrounding the chimney is equally vital. Inspect whether the surroundings surrounding your home's chimney is neat and that there are tree branches hindering the upper section.

Maintain a Small Flame

Refrain from burning an overly large load of wood simultaneously. The spot for combusting wood is at a firewood grate toward the back of the fire pit. Burning too much wood at one time can result in accumulated creosote over time, which might lead to chimney stack cracking.

Keep an eye on the Fire

Always walk away from a unattended fire. Ignited particles and logs can tumble from the fireplace grate as it is burning, which could be propelled. This carries the potential of start an unwanted fire.

Huntington Woods is situated along the Woodward Corridor (M-1) and is bounded by Ten and Eleven Mile Roads to the north and south and by Woodward and Coolidge Highway to the east and west. The city is widely known as the "City of Homes", as it consists mostly of residences. Rackham Golf Course is located along the southern end of the city. The western portion of the Detroit Zoo is located within the city limits and is a contributor to its tax base.
